He Yi-hang (Chinese: 賀一航; born 31 July 1956) is a Taiwanese television host and actor. He has won two Golden Bell Awards, once each in 2006 and 2016.[1]

In 2004, a group of people attacked He by striking him with baseball bats, causing injuries to his leg, arm and face.[2] He was linked to patronage of a brothel in August 2010, and charged with drug possession after a subsequent investigation.[3][4] Shortly thereafter, He posted bail and was released from prison.[5] He later reported to the Shilin Administrative Enforcement Agency and was questioned about tax evasion.[6]
